From 3d7c28ed9973ab2b8a4094433c49e78097771ccb Mon Sep 17 00:00:00 2001 From: David Herman Date: Fri, 12 Apr 2024 14:01:37 -0700 Subject: [PATCH] update workflows to use latest versions of deps --- .github/workflows/coverage-badge.yml | 8 ++++---- .github/workflows/gradle-test-all.yml | 8 ++++---- .github/workflows/publish.yml | 10 +++++----- 3 files changed, 13 insertions(+), 13 deletions(-) diff --git a/.github/workflows/coverage-badge.yml b/.github/workflows/coverage-badge.yml index 13e7595..a563728 100644 --- a/.github/workflows/coverage-badge.yml +++ b/.github/workflows/coverage-badge.yml @@ -11,19 +11,19 @@ jobs: runs-on: ubuntu-latest steps: - - uses: actions/checkout@v3 + - uses: actions/checkout@v4 # Java 17 needed for resolving the Android Gradle Plugin - - uses: actions/setup-java@v3 + - uses: actions/setup-java@v4 with: distribution: temurin java-version: 17 - name: Setup Gradle - uses: gradle/gradle-build-action@v2 + uses: gradle/actions/setup-gradle@v3 - name: Cache Kotlin Native compiler - uses: actions/cache@v3 + uses: actions/cache@v4 with: path: ~/.konan key: kotlin-native-compiler-${{ runner.OS }} diff --git a/.github/workflows/gradle-test-all.yml b/.github/workflows/gradle-test-all.yml index 46d434e..05a72a3 100644 --- a/.github/workflows/gradle-test-all.yml +++ b/.github/workflows/gradle-test-all.yml @@ -16,19 +16,19 @@ jobs: os: [ubuntu-latest] steps: - - uses: actions/checkout@v3 + - uses: actions/checkout@v4 # Java 17 needed for resolving the Android Gradle Plugin - - uses: actions/setup-java@v3 + - uses: actions/setup-java@v4 with: distribution: temurin java-version: 17 - name: Setup Gradle - uses: gradle/gradle-build-action@v2 + uses: gradle/actions/setup-gradle@v3 - name: Cache Kotlin Native compiler - uses: actions/cache@v3 + uses: actions/cache@v4 with: path: ~/.konan key: kotlin-native-compiler-${{ runner.OS }} diff --git a/.github/workflows/publish.yml b/.github/workflows/publish.yml index 240a1bd..6ee79e0 100644 --- a/.github/workflows/publish.yml +++ b/.github/workflows/publish.yml @@ -76,19 +76,19 @@ jobs: ) run: echo "This workflow will run because the inputs are relevant to this machine." - - uses: actions/checkout@v3 + - uses: actions/checkout@v4 if: steps.shouldrun.conclusion == 'success' # Java 11 needed for resolving the Android Gradle Plugin - - uses: actions/setup-java@v3 + - uses: actions/setup-java@v4 if: steps.shouldrun.conclusion == 'success' with: distribution: temurin - java-version: 11 + java-version: 17 - name: Setup Gradle if: steps.shouldrun.conclusion == 'success' - uses: gradle/gradle-build-action@v2 + uses: gradle/actions/setup-gradle@v3 - name: Add secret Gradle properties if: steps.shouldrun.conclusion == 'success' @@ -102,7 +102,7 @@ jobs: - name: Cache Kotlin Native compiler if: steps.shouldrun.conclusion == 'success' - uses: actions/cache@v3 + uses: actions/cache@v4 with: path: ~/.konan key: kotlin-native-compiler-${{ runner.OS }}